3 well established, listed companies and their performance on the market to be discussed during medirectalk

 

MeDirect Bank is organising a ninth medirectalk investment webinar which will be discussing the performance of 3 well established, listed companies and their performance on the market. The event will take place online, on 18th November 2021 at 18.00hrs and is free of charge.  

The upcoming medirectalk is organised by MeDirect Bank Malta, together with Blue Whale Growth Fund. The webinar will start with an overview of 3 well established, listed companies, Alphabet, Microsoft and Nvidia and their performance on the market. Stephen Yiu, Chief Investment Officer at Blue Whale Capital and Lead Manager of the Blue Whale Growth Fund, will also be giving an insight on the management of the funds he manages and how these stocks have affected the fund.

Stephen Yiu, co-founded Blue Whale Capital in 2016, with Peter Hargreaves who is a co-founder of Hargreaves Lansdown. Yiu started his career at Hargreaves Lansdown before working with Tim Steer as a co-manager at New Star Asset Management (now Janus Henderson) and Artemis Investment Management. Most recently, Yiu worked under Martin Taylor and Nick Barnes at Nevsky Capital, a global long-short equity hedge fund.

Born in Hong Kong, Yiu grew up in Singapore before completing his education in the UK. A fluent speaker of English, Cantonese and Mandarin, Yiu is truly a global citizen, and with his 15 years of investment experience, is well equipped to manage portfolios in the new global economy.

The Blue Whale Growth Fund is a global equity fund, focussing on large-cap stocks in developed markets. The Fund was launched in September 2017 and since inception it is the best performing fund out of 300 in the IA Global sector. The five-member investment team, led by Yiu, embraces a high conviction, valuation-driven approach to stock selection. At any given point, the fund will be invested into the best 25 to 35 stocks.
